Peri-naise is the famous creamy pink mayonnaise based sauce from Nando’s, the Portuguese chicken chain known for their Peri Peri chicken. They use it in Per Peri Burgers and wraps, for dipping fries and wedges, dunking chicken and drizzling over rice bowls. I also use it for tacos, burritos and quesadillas – to name a few!

Peri-naise! The creamy sauce that combines Nando’s signature Peri Peri sauce with mayonnaise, hence the name – Peri-naise.

It’s a quick and easy sauce that’s lived as part of my Peri Peri Chicken Burgers recipe, but thought I’d write it up as a separate recipe too because it’s there’s so many uses for it. Also, I make it two ways – one with Peri Peri Sauce, and the other with a Peri Peri seasoning (handy, because it uses pantry spices).

What you need to make Peri-naise

Here are the ingredients you need for each version to make my homemade Peri-naise:

  1. Peri Peri Sauce version – I use this when I make a homemade Peri Peri sauce (you could probably use store bought too, but I haven’t tried that). See here for my homemade Peri Peri sauce.

Nandos Peri Peri Chicken Burger
  1. Dried spices version – this is the quick I one I make most of the time, made using dried spices. Try to make it at least 30 minutes ahead of time to give the flavours time to melt, and adjust the thickness using lemon juice depending on how you plan to use it: thicker for burger smearing, thinner for drizzling over bowls (like Portuguese Chicken and Rice which I also published today).

What to use Peri-naise for

Drizzling, dipping and smearing! Peri-naise has a creamy-savoury-slightly tangy flavour that makes it endlessly versatile, so it goes with loads of things. Here are some suggestions:

  • Peri Peri Chicken Burgers – this is the classic sauce used by Nando’s

  • Any other burger – from cheeseburgers to Crispy Chicken Burgers, filet-o-fish to a classic beef burger, or even steak sandwiches

  • Dipping sauce for fries and wedges

  • Drizzling on tacos – especially fabulous with Fish Tacos, Prawn Tacos (Shrimp) and Crunchy chicken taco fingers (baked!)

  • Dunking sauce for burritos, quesadillas, wraps like Chicken Shawarma, doner kebabs (chicken or lamb/beef)

  • Bowls and salads – Like Portuguese Chicken and Rice, Mexican Avocado Chicken Salad, Tuna Poke Bowl

Peri-naise is the famous creamy pink sauce from Nando's, the Portuguese chicken restaurant chain. They use it for burgers, in wraps, dipping fries and drizzling on rice and salad bowls.
Here's the two ways I make it – one based on a homemade Peri Peri sauce (tastes a little "fresher"), and the other to make anytime using dried spices (more similar to store bought bottles).

Ingredients

PERI PERI SAUCE VERSION:

  • 3 tbsp Peri Peri Sauce from this recipe
  • 3/4 cup mayonnaise , preferably whole egg (Note 1)

DRY SPICE VERSION (quicker, make anytime)

  • 3/4 cup mayonnaise , preferably whole egg (Note 1)
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ika (sub regular paprika)
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der (sub fresh garlic, finely grated)
  • 1/2 tsp onion powder
  • 1/4 tsp cayenne pepper (adjust or remove for not spicy)
  • 1/2 tsp white sugar
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ice (or apple cider vinegar)
  • 1/4 tsp cooking salt / kosher salt

Instructions

  • Mix – For both versions, mix ingredients in a bowl and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es before using to let the flavours meld, if you can.
  • Use for burgers and wraps, dipping (like fries, crunchy tenders, popcorn chicken), drizzling on salad and rice bowls, poke bowls etc. See list of suggested recipes in post!
  • Storage – The Peri Peri Sauce version will keep 5 days in the fridge, the dry spices one will keep for at least a week. Not suitable for freezing.

Recipe Notes:

1. Whole egg mayonnaise is creamier and less vinegary than other types of mayonnaise sold at grocery stores. It’s the only type I get, except Kewpie which is even better!
Lighten it up a touch by substituting 1/3 of the mayonnaise with sour cream or yogurt (though it loosens the sauce a touch).
Nutrition for the whole recipe. If using for drizzling like I do in Portuguese Chicken and Rice bowls, you don’t need very much – literally about 1 tablespoon per bowl, if that.
